4/20/77: Winfield Stars as Chester Springs Nicks Lionville, 3-2

Tiger-Cats manager Jon Brams
It turned my stomach to watch Winfield steal 2nd and 3rd in succession in the 8th and then score the winning run on a sac. fly by that perpetual thorn in our side, Royster. And Reitz failing to get the bat off his shoulder with the tying run on 2nd in the 9th … what was that? Lefty pitched well enough to win, but we're just having a devil of a time at the plate with runners in scoring position. Plus, we grounded into 3 double plays. I'm not sure if I should keep tinkering around the edges or really shuffle the lineup - maybe even put Bull out in the field. Gonna sleep on it - if I can. I hope Swan can get us out of here with a win tomorrow.
